A new Cold War threatens the galaxy in this fast-paced and wisecracking thriller of spies and subterfuge.

Simon Kovalic, top intelligence operative for the Commonwealth of Independent Systems, is on the front line of the burgeoning Cold War with the aggressive Illyrican Empire. He barely escapes his latest mission with a broken arm and vital intel that points to the empire cozying up to the Bayern Corporation: a planet-sized bank. There’s no time to waste, but with Kovalic out of action, his undercover team is handed over to his ex-wife, Lt. Commander Natalie Taylor. When Kovalic’s boss is tipped off that the Imperium are ready and waiting, it’s up to the wounded spy to rescue his team and complete the mission before they’re all caught and executed.

Two things stand out with this book: first, Dan More is really good at writing dialogue. That may be due at least partially to the second thing that stands out, which is Victor Bevine's gorgeous narration. I first heard him read Hyperion - and if you haven't read that one I highly recommend it - and he brings a sort of velvety gravitas to the story and dialogue here.

Beyond the dialogue, the story itself is engaging and well written. It moves along briskly and the characters and relatable and engaging. Each is defined without being pedantic about it and the universe in which they operate has its own set of interesting characteristics.

My only quibble is that there are some places in the book in which I experienced a noticeable shift in the audio, almost as if the narrator re-recorded a sentence with a different mic or in a different space. That's distracting from the immersion and takes a few seconds to adjust to. But the story and the performance are both excellent.
